Background: Lack of proper sealing of canal leads leakage and penetration of smear layer into the canal which is the most important factor for failure of root canal treatment. Purpose: The objective of the research was to compare the apical leakage between Glass Ionomer Cement and Endomethasone as a sealer either with or without irrigation of EDTA 15%. Method: Thirty two lower premolar – root human teeth was divided into 4 groups (n=8). The teeth root length was made similar to 15 mm. The groups were instrumented to apply K – type files with step back technique. During the preparation, irrigation is done using NaOCl 5,25% and gutapercha obturated with lateral condensation technique. The first group was irrigated using 10 ml EDTA 15% and then 10 ml NaOCl 5,25%. The second was irrigated using 10 ml NaOCl 5,25%. The first and the second utilized Glas Ionomer Cement sealers. The third was irrigated using 10 ml EDTA 15% and then 10 ml NaOCl 5,25%. The fourth utilized 10 ml NaOCl 5,25%. The third and fourth groups utilized Endomethasone sealers. All teeth were being rontgen and then kept in relative humidity during 2 days. The root surfaces were coated with nail varnish and immersed in black ink. The research was analyzed using Anava and T test. Result: Difference apical leakage occured at 4 groups. The apical leakage of GIC sealers was smaller than the endomethasone. Conclusion: The irrigations of EDTA shows a smaller apical leakage compared to the one without EDTA.
